|
CARMA C++
|
CalibrationControlImpl Corba control class. More...
#include <carma/antenna/ovro/control/CalibratorControlImpl.h>
Public Member Functions | |
| CalibratorControlImpl (carma::antenna::ovro::Optics &optics) | |
| Constructor. More... | |
| void | setPos (carma::antenna::common::CalibratorControl::Position position) |
| void | setPos (carma::antenna::common::CalibratorControl::Position position,::CORBA::ULong seqNo) |
| void | setPos (carma::antenna::common::CalibratorControl::Position position, unsigned long seqNo, bool withRxSeqNo) |
| Set calibrator position. More... | |
| ~CalibratorControlImpl () | |
| Destructor. More... | |
CalibrationControlImpl Corba control class.
This class implements the IDL defined interface for antenna calibration and dispatches commands to appropriate CAN devices via delegation.
Definition at line 33 of file CalibratorControlImpl.h.
| carma::antenna::ovro::CalibratorControlImpl::CalibratorControlImpl | ( | carma::antenna::ovro::Optics & | optics | ) |
Constructor.
| optics | Pointer to underlying ovro optics CAN device. |
| carma::antenna::ovro::CalibratorControlImpl::~CalibratorControlImpl | ( | ) |
Destructor.
| void carma::antenna::ovro::CalibratorControlImpl::setPos | ( | carma::antenna::common::CalibratorControl::Position | position, |
| unsigned long | seqNo, | ||
| bool | withRxSeqNo | ||
| ) |
Set calibrator position.
| position | Calibrator position to set. |
| seqNo | Sequence number to return in either the calibrator or receiver common monitor subsystems when complete (or timedout). |
| withRxSeqNo | If true place sequence number in receiver monitor system. If false, place in calibrator common monitor system. |